Transaction e746e328d7afa1dee1111b64e90118e559c125a58f30f5cdd888bb69a21aef24

block
7638b0e9e6dffdf6e81b9bf6609772fcc74698689ab3cdd0ec21da3b1ff6761c

1 Input

26 Outputs